A leak which has revealed that Sony Ericsson will be releasing the successor to the X10 Mini Pro has emerged. The Android smartphone is yet to have a name stuck to it, but some of the leaked device's specs have been revealed to gawk at.
The X10 Mini Pro successor is set to feature a slide-out QWERTY keyboard and a rather small (unsurprisingly) 3-inch multitouch screen which has a 320×480 pixel resolution. The leaked image also reveals a camera with what looks like an LED flash on the rear, but no specs regarding it have been exposed.
Other specs the device has been revealed to have include either an 800MHz or 1GHz processor (hopefully the latter), and an Adreno 205 GPU. The device is also looking to be running Google's latest version of their mobile OS Android 2.3 Gingerbread.
Unfortunately there is not much else revealed about the phone besides the aesthetic differences from its predecessor you can see from the leaked photo. Hopefully more information on the device will be heading our way about the tiny smartphone.
